About

Jingjing Chen is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pharmacology and Plant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Jingjing Chen has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 681 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Molecular Biology, 11 papers in Pharmacology and 10 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Jingjing Chen's work include Plant biochemistry and biosynthesis (8 papers),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(7 papers) and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(7 papers). Jingjing Chen is often cited by papers focused on Plant biochemistry and biosynthesis (8 papers),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(7 papers) and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(7 papers). Jingjing Chen coll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Jingjing Chen's co-authors include Ting Gong, Ping Zhu, Jin‐Ling Yang, Tian-Jiao Chen, Wan-Cang Liu, Xiao Liang, Peng Jin, Yingying Zhao, Hong Zhu and Yonghua Zheng and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, The Journal of Experimental Medicine and PLoS ONE.
